We are kicking off at restaurant Ratatouille in Meerbusch, where my good friend Sami shows us how to barbecue catfish, served with traditional Persian Tahdig rice. • Ingredients (serves 4): 500-800g catfish fillet 1 shredded onion 2 shredded tomatoes 1/2 grated nutmeg 1/2 lemon juice 1g saffron Tahdig rice: 500g Basmati rice 500ml water Oil • Recipe: 1. Fillet the fish as shown in this reel and stick onto skewers. 2. Marinade: combine shredded veggies and spices in a bowl and marinate the fish in it overnight. 3. Tahdig rice: wash the rice well and put in a rice cooker with the water and oil. Cook for 25 min and flip onto a serving plate. 4. Over charcoals, grill the fish skewers on both sides for 6-8 minutes and serve with the rice and a fresh salad. Enjoy! • #catfishing #catfish #fishinglife #tahdig #catchandcook #fishrecipe
